Hi there. So I have a workbook with several tabs in it, and in each of them, I have a named range called "SHIP" that refers to one single cell with a number in it. Below is a screenshot of the name manager so you can see what I'm working with...

https://preview.redd.it/s9q2t2tituog1.png?width=529&format=png&auto=webp&s=62d6409faed25624416e71ffa3c9b9966a3613bd

I use them for two things: 1) in each of these tabs, there is a hyperlink to this cell so that I don't have to scroll way down to see it; 2) in another workbook, I have links to pull the value from each of these cells.

This was working without issue for a while. Then, this week, every single morning those links break. The hyperlinks give me a pop-up error saying the reference is invalid, and the data references show a #NAME? error. If I reenter the formulas exactly the same, they work fine, and the named ranges are still in the name manager unchanged. For the links in a separate workbook, it doesn't matter if I have this workbook open already, they still don't work. Actually, one time they worked until I opened the source workbook, then I got a #NAME? error. What the heck is going on?! Did I define the names improperly or something?

(This is Office 365 business version, btw!)
